Microsoft: no support for Windows XP

Yesterday, April 08, 2014, was the day Microsoft ended it’s support for the all-time most popular operating system (OS) – Windows XP. it’s been 12 years after it’s release and Windows will be no longer supporting, patching up and guarding users from hackers that may use this news to their advantage. One may think that Windows XP may be a somewhat hipster and not so popular OS, but in reality it’s still widely used in practically everywhere from your home desktop to heating and air-conditioning systems in your office. It is estimated that an astonishing number of 95% ATM’s world-wide are still running on XP. Computers in hospitals, policy stations and other important locations are known to prefer XP as well. Lauri Love charged for hacking into Federal Reserve Bank

Prosecutors are trying to prove that Lauri Love is responsible for breaking in to the Federal Reserve Bank of New York and releasing private information and names. The hacker is well known in the media because previously he was charged with multiple crimes such as hacking into the Energy Department and the Environmental Protection Agency, the Army, Health and Human Services, NASA, Regional Computer Forensics Laboratory and Missile Defence Agency. Kickstarter hacked

Apparently, the largest crowd-funded website original ideas has been attacked by hackers. Cyber criminals managed to steal personal information like passwords and logins from Kickstarter users. Although no credit cards or it’s information has been stolen, hackers managed to get out with passwords, usernames, phone numbers, email’s and mailing adresses.  Such message should be very alarming to the users. Bitcoin downfall

Half a year ago it was hard to imagine that the cryptocurrency “bitcoins” would fail to reach $1000 price per unit. The reality today is quite different. Now bitcoins can not shake away the image of an unstable, not trust-worthy and criminal currency. Russia’s top prosecutor, released a statement that bitcoins are completely illegal and can not have any source of authority. One of the world’s largest bitcoin exchange company, Mt. Gox, prevented the investors from pulling out their bitcoins out of the market, suggesting a glitch in a system. Apple store cleared it’s shelves from the last bitcoin wallet and authorities arrested BitInstant CEO.
